Horrific injuries 8-months’ pregnant woman suffered after two pitbulls savaged her, her boyfriend and their Jack Russell
A PREGNANT woman suffered horrific injuries after two pitbulls savaged her, her boyfriend and their Jack Russell.
The vicious animal struck as the couple and their dog walked along Hadrian's Wall path in Newcastle.
The woman, who is eight months pregnant, suffered deep gashes to her forearm and elbows while her partner was left needing plastic surgery after sustaining a puncture would to his arm.
Their dog also required emergency vet treatment.
The horror unfolded after the pitbulls freed themselves from a man's lead.
They then bit the couple's Jack Russell on the neck, and that's when the man and woman intervened, police said.
Moments later, the hounds turned on them and the couple ran into the road.
They flagged down a passing lorry driver for help, and he took the injured pup into his cabin.
It is not known in which direction the owner of the two dogs left the scene.

Officers are now appealing for him or anyone who may know him to come forward.
He is described as a slim, white male in his 30s or 40s, who was balding and wearing all green.
He had a sleeping bag on the ground with him at the time.
His dogs are described as a light tanned colour and their ears had not been cropped.
It is understood one was male with a black collar while one was female wearing a pink collar.
